帮忙编一下程序

来源:百度知道 编辑:UC知道 时间:2024/05/07 10:46:39
编程实现:由用户从键盘输入一串字符(以回车键结束),统计其中数字,大小写字母,空格,其它字符的个数.
(1)通过键盘输入字符.
(2)给出相应的输入/输出信息提示.并按照数字,大写字母,小写字母,空格,其他字符数的顺序输出结果.

主要是不会统计一串字符,只会区别一个字符是什么字符 ,请高手指教!!

#include<stdio.h>
void main()
{

int big=0,null=0,small=0,num=0;
char c=0;
clrscr();
printf("input something\n");
while(c!='\n')
{
c=getchar();
if (c<='Z'&&c>='A')
big+=1;
if (c<='z'&&c>='a')
small+=1;
if (c<='9'&&c>='0')
num+=1;
if (c==32)
null+=1;
else
other+=1;
}
printf("Big=%d,small=%d,number=%d,null=%d",big,small,num,null);
getch();
}

strcmp(char* src,char* dest,sizeof(ch));

统计一串字符用数组啊!